Funny or Die has used the obsession with Fifty Shades of Grey to their advantage.
The site previously teased “brace yourselves for the best video of all time,” about their newest video, which stars Selena Gomez.
On Monday, Gomez teased the clip by posting a photo of herself reading Fifty Shades of Grey with the caption “Catching up on some reading on set with Funny or Die.” On Tuesday, fans finally got a taste of the video Gomez stars in for the website. She stars in “Fifty Shades of Blue,” a parody of E.L James’ bestseller.
In the clip, Selena finds herself swooning over a painter, played by Nick Kroll, after reading the novel. The painter, Carl Blue, has come over to paint a wall for her. He is the complete opposite of the fantasy guy she believes she has met. Her fantasy also allows her to believe he is not painting a wall, but doing something special for her.
When his work is done, she fails to sign paperwork, but instead leaves her phone number and hugs and kisses. The whole situation is confusing and creepy for Carl.
“For a girl who doesn’t talk at all, you have full on creeped me out,” he says. “This has been bizarre.”
